Musk Perfume Notes: The Complete Guide to Musk Fragrances
Musk is one of the most important and widely used perfume notes, known for its smooth, soft and long-lasting scent. It plays a crucial role in modern perfumery by adding warmth, depth and longevity while helping fragrances feel balanced and complete.
Unlike brighter notes that fade quickly, musk develops gradually and remains noticeable throughout the life of the fragrance. It is most commonly used as a base note, where it provides a smooth foundation and enhances overall performance.
Musk perfumes can range from clean and subtle to rich and sensual depending on how the note is blended. This versatility makes musk one of the most valuable and versatile ingredients in fragrance creation.

Musk is a foundational perfume note known for its smooth, warm and long-lasting scent. Traditionally, musk was derived from natural animal sources, but modern perfumery uses safe, synthetic musk compounds that recreate the same soft, clean and slightly powdery aroma. Musk is used as a base note because it helps anchor the fragrance and improve longevity, allowing other notes to develop more smoothly over time. Its subtle warmth and skin-like character make it an essential ingredient in many perfumes, adding depth, balance and a refined finish to the overall scent.

What Does Musk Smell Like in a Perfume?
Musk perfume notes are typically smooth, soft and warm, with a subtle depth that enhances other ingredients. Modern musk used in perfumery is carefully designed to create a clean, balanced and long-lasting scent.
Musk in perfume can smell:
- Smooth and soft
- Clean and slightly powdery
- Warm and comforting
- Subtle and elegant
- Deep and long-lasting
Musk often acts as a supporting note, helping other fragrance ingredients perform better and last longer.
Why Musk is Used in Perfume
Musk is essential in perfumery because it improves both longevity and overall fragrance quality. It helps bind the fragrance together and ensures it develops smoothly over time.
Key benefits of musk in perfume include:
- Excellent longevity
- Enhances fragrance smoothness
- Improves overall performance
- Creates a clean and balanced scent
- Works well with almost all fragrance types
Because of these qualities, musk appears in the vast majority of modern perfumes.

How Musk Works With Other Perfume Notes
Musk blends exceptionally well with many other fragrance ingredients, enhancing both performance and scent quality.
Common musk pairings include:
- Vanilla – adds warmth and smooth sweetness
- Amber – enhances softness & longevity
- Oud – improves smoothness & longevity
- Rose – creates smoothness & longevity
- Jasmine– creates a clean & fresh scent
These combinations help create fragrances that are both long-lasting and well balanced.
